In a time when global challenges feel increasingly complex, World NGO Day stands as a reminder that solutions often begin at the grassroots level. Celebrated every year on February 27, this international observance honors non-governmental organizations (NGOs) that dedicate their efforts to serving humanity. As we look ahead to World NGO Day 2026 , the message is clear—lasting impact requires participation, partnership, and purpose.  NGOs play a crucial role in addressing social issues that affect millions, from healthcare inequality to disability inclusion, education gaps, and hunger relief. World NGO Day brings these efforts into the spotlight while encouraging individuals and institutions to contribute meaningfully. The Growing Relevance of World NGO Day When World NGO Day was first globally observed in 2014, it aimed to recognize the contributions of nonprofit organizations worldwide. For most of us, daily tasks happen without a second thought. We wake up, brush our teeth, prepare meals, send messages, drive to work, and complete countless small actions using our hands and arms. But for someone who has lost an upper limb, these ordinary routines can become daily obstacles. The loss affects not only physical movement but also emotional confidence and financial stability. Access to advanced solutions like Prosthetic Arms  can help transform this struggle into a story of resilience and recovery. For underprivileged individuals, however, the opportunity to receive quality Prosthetic Arms often depends on charitable support. While technology has progressed rapidly, affordability remains the biggest barrier. Without assistance, many capable individuals are left without the tools they need to rebuild their independence. Communities in the United States are strongest when people look out for one another. In a time when daily life feels rushed and impersonal, small moments of kindness can restore connection and trust. This is why Random Acts of Kindness Day has become so meaningful—it highlights how everyday actions can strengthen communities and uplift lives. Celebrated each year in February, this day encourages Americans to pause and act with intention. Whether it’s helping a stranger, supporting a nonprofit, or spreading encouragement, kindness has the power to create real social change.
